What Matters Most In This Climate
Sun dries finishes, humidity swells boards, and sprinklers leave mineral marks. The cure is simple. Keep finish in good shape, let the base breathe, and keep water off the face where you can.
Simple Care That Works
- Rinse and wipe when you see dust or sprinkler marks. A hose and soft brush are enough in most cases.
- Trim vegetation so plants and vines do not rest on the boards. Keep mulch a few inches away so the base dries out after rain.
- Aim sprinklers away from the fence. Hard water streaks fade finish faster than sun alone.

When To Reseal or Restain
Watch how water behaves. If it stops beading and starts soaking in, it is time to refresh the finish. In open sun that is often every two to three years. In
deep shade or heavy overspray areas, sooner makes sense. Use exterior products rated for high UV exposure.
Gate Tuneups You Can Do
Gates see the most movement. If one drags or latches tight, check hinge bolts and the striker alignment. Small turns usually bring it back into line. If it still feels off, we can tune it.
